1.先用jsoup的包将html格式化。(此处用于解析html代码。方便后面用itext包调用) 2.利用iText的jar包,这个jar包是转化pdf用到的,但是转化成word也能用。保存后在word里面的文件类型是.rtf格式的。能够完美解决问题。 成功后的结果: 文件类型: Demo地址: http://download.csdn.net/download/wht21888/10120532 具体...
Java 将 RTF 转换为 HTML 格式 importcom.spire.doc.*;publicclassRTFToHTML {publicstaticvoidmain(String[] args) {//加载RTF文档Document document =newDocument(); document.loadFromFile("测试.rtf", FileFormat.Rtf);//将RTF保存为HTML格式document.saveToFile("Rtf转Html.html", FileFormat.Html); document...
importorg.apache.poi.xwpf.usermodel.XWPFDocument;importorg.apache.poi.xwpf.usermodel.XWPFParagraph;importorg.apache.poi.xwpf.usermodel.XWPFRun;importorg.jsoup.Jsoup;importorg.jsoup.nodes.Document;importorg.jsoup.nodes.Element;importjava.io.FileOutputStream;importjava.io.IOException;publicclassHtmlToWord{publ...
Reasonably priced, highly specialized compact Java library for creating high-quality, accessible PDF and RTF from styled HTML for print and long-term eArchiving
先利用jsoup将得到的html代码“标准化”(Jsoup.parse(String html))方法,然后利用FileWiter将此html内容写到本地的template.doc文件中,此时如果文章中包含图片的话,template.doc就会依赖你的本地图片文件路径,如果你将图片更改一个名称或者将路径更改,再打开这个template.doc,图片就会显示不出来(出现一个叉叉)。为了解...
我可以使用 JEditorPane 来解析 rtf 文本并将其转换为 html。但是 html 输出缺少某种格式,即本例中的删除线标记。正如您在输出中看到的那样,下划线文本已正确包装在中,但没有删除线包装器。任何的想法? public void testRtfToHtml() { JEditorPane pane = new JEditorPane(); ...
EN我需要将HTML转换为RTF,并使用以下代码:本指南介绍如何在 Linux 中将图像转换为 ASCII 格式。我们将...
将RTF中的格式信息转换为相应的HTML标签和CSS样式。例如,将RTF中的加粗文本转换为HTML的<b>标签,将段落转换为<p>标签等。 构建HTML文档结构: 创建HTML文档的基本结构,包括<html>、<head>和<body>标签。 将转换后的HTML内容插入到HTML文档结构中: 将步骤3中生成的HTML...
步骤1 较为简单,可以先用 word 或者 wps 打开 rtf 文件,然后 文件 另存为 doc 即可。如果一个文件可以这样操作,如果有多上百个文件这样操作肯定较为繁琐,可以查看这篇文章,批量将 rtf 另存为 doc 格式。 步骤2 可以参考网上的这篇文章, 通过Apache POI将 doc 转成 html 格式,且样式图片不会丢失。
富文本字符串是一种包含了文字样式、颜色、字体等格式信息的字符串,例如HTML代码或者RTF格式。而纯文本则是一种只包含文字内容而不包含格式信息的字符串。在实际应用中,我们可能需要将富文本字符串转为纯文本以便于后续操作。 Java实现富文本字符串转纯文本 ...